*{margin:0;padding:0;box-sizing:border-box;font-family:Poppins,Arial,Helvetica,sans-serif}body{background-color:#000;color:#f5f5f5;scrollbar-width:thin;scrollbar-color:rgba(0,0,0,.3) transparent}a{color:#f5f5f5;text-decoration:none}::-webkit-scrollbar{width:6px;height:6px}::-webkit-scrollbar-track{background:transparent}::-webkit-scrollbar-thumb{background:#0000004d;border-radius:3px}.btn{font-size:1rem;font-weight:500;padding:.7rem 1.4rem;border-radius:100rem;border:none;background-color:#3b913b;transition:background-color .2s ease-in-out}.btn:hover{cursor:pointer;background-color:#006800}.btn:active{background-color:#003200}.containerFull{padding:0 1rem;display:flex;justify-content:center;border-top-left-radius:2rem;border-top-right-radius:2rem;background:linear-gradient(#141414 30%,#0a0a0a)}.containerFit{width:1250px;display:flex}.App{display:grid;grid-template:80px calc(100vh - 80px) / 1fr}.NavBar{grid-area:span 1 / span 2}.main{width:100%;grid-area:span 1 / span 2;display:grid;grid-template:1fr 3fr 60px / 1fr 1fr;column-gap:1rem}.SearchBarContainer{grid-area:span 1 / span 2}.TrackResultsContainer,.PlaylistContainer{overflow:hidden;grid-area:span 1 / span 1;display:grid;grid-template:60px 1fr / 1fr}.ModalContainer{padding:10px;position:absolute;top:70px}.creditsContainer{grid-area:span 1 / span 2;display:flex;justify-content:space-between;align-items:center}.developerContainer a{text-decoration:underline}.spotifyContainer{display:flex;align-items:center;gap:.5rem}.spotifyLogo{width:100px}@media only screen and (max-width: 1250px){.containerFit{width:100%}}@media only screen and (max-width: 1060px){.App{grid-template:80px calc(100% - 80px) / 1fr}.main{grid-template:100px 500px 500px 60px/ 100%}.main.playlist{grid-template:100px calc(100vh - 240px) 60px / 100%}.SearchBarContainer,.creditsContainer{grid-area:span 1 / span 1}}@media only screen and (max-width: 540px){.main{grid-template:100px 500px 500px 120px/ 100%}.main.playlist{grid-template:100px 650px 120px / 100%}.creditsContainer{padding:1rem 0;flex-direction:column;justify-content:center;gap:1rem}}._navBar_12nw8_1{display:flex;justify-content:center;padding:1rem;background-color:#0007}._containerFit_12nw8_8{display:flex;justify-content:space-between}._navLogo_12nw8_13{display:flex;align-items:center;gap:.5rem;font-size:2rem;font-weight:600}._playifyLogo_12nw8_21{width:40px}._loginContainer_12nw8_25{display:flex;align-items:center;justify-content:flex-end}._userProfile_12nw8_31:hover{cursor:pointer;background-color:#bbb}._userImage_12nw8_36{border-radius:100rem;height:100%;transition:box-shadow .1s ease-in-out}._userImage_12nw8_36:hover{cursor:pointer;box-shadow:0 0 0 5px #363636}._userPanel_12nw8_47{width:220px;padding:.5rem;overflow:hidden;z-index:10;position:absolute;top:4.5rem;display:flex;flex-direction:column;gap:.5rem;border-radius:.6rem;background-color:#363636}._userPanelOption_12nw8_64{color:#f5f5f5;display:flex;justify-content:space-between;align-items:center;padding:1rem;border-radius:5px}a._userPanelOption_12nw8_64:hover{background-color:#505050}._searchBarContainer_14m46_1{width:100%;display:flex;justify-content:center}._searchBarForm_14m46_7{width:100%;display:flex;flex-direction:column;justify-content:center;align-items:center;gap:1rem}._searchLabel_14m46_16{font-size:2rem;font-weight:600}._playlistQuote_14m46_21{font-size:2rem;font-weight:600;align-self:center}._searchBarButtonContainer_14m46_27{display:flex;gap:1rem}._searchBarDiv_14m46_32{width:400px;display:flex;align-items:center;padding:0 1.2rem;border-radius:100rem;background-color:#1f1f1f;transition:box-shadow .3s ease-in-out,background-color .2s ease-in-out}._searchBarDiv_14m46_32:hover{box-shadow:0 0 0 1px #ccc4 inset;background-color:#2a2a2a}._searchBarDiv_14m46_32:focus{box-shadow:0 0 0 2px #dbdbdb inset;background-color:#2a2a2a;outline:none}._searchButton_14m46_53{border:none;background:transparent}._searchIcon_14m46_59{color:#cccccc9a;transition:color .3s ease-in-out}._searchIcon_14m46_59:hover{cursor:pointer;color:#e0e0e0}._searchBar_14m46_1{width:100%;max-width:350px;padding:.7rem 1rem;border:none;font-size:1.2rem;font-weight:400;color:#e0e0e0;background-color:transparent}._searchBar_14m46_1:focus{outline:none}._xMark_14m46_84{color:#9e9e9e}._xMark_14m46_84:hover{color:#e0e0e0;cursor:pointer}._xMarkHidden_14m46_93{visibility:hidden}@media only screen and (max-width: 1060px){._searchBarContainer_14m46_1{padding:1rem 0 0;align-items:flex-start}._searchBarButtonContainer_14m46_27,._searchBarDiv_14m46_32{width:100%}._searchLabel_14m46_16{display:none}._searchBar_14m46_1{max-width:none}}@media only screen and (max-width: 540px){._searchBar_14m46_1{font-size:1rem}}._resultsHeader_1fvgf_1{display:flex;align-items:end;justify-content:space-between;gap:1rem;margin-bottom:1rem}._resultsTitle_1fvgf_9{font-size:1.7rem;font-weight:600;line-height:1;flex:2 1}._hiddenButton_1fvgf_16{flex:1 1;visibility:hidden}._trackResults_1fvgf_21{overflow:hidden;padding:1.5rem;background-color:#1f1f1f;border-radius:.7rem}@media only screen and (max-width: 1060px){._trackResults_1fvgf_21{max-height:400px}}@media only screen and (max-width: 540px){._resultsTitle_1fvgf_9{font-size:1.5rem}}._detailsColumns_1rev8_1{display:grid;padding-left:4rem;grid-template:1fr / 5fr 3fr 2fr 1fr;align-items:center;border-bottom:1px solid rgba(245,245,245,.5);color:#e0e0e0;font-weight:300}._albumColumn_1rev8_12{justify-self:flex-start}._durationColumn_1rev8_16{justify-self:center}._trackList_1rev8_20{height:100%;overflow-y:scroll;padding:1.5rem 0;margin:0;list-style-type:none;display:grid;align-content:start;row-gap:1rem}@media only screen and (max-width: 540px){._detailsColumns_1rev8_1{grid-template:1fr / 3fr 1fr}._durationColumn_1rev8_16,._albumColumn_1rev8_12{display:none}}._track_1kac2_1{width:100%;height:fit-content;display:flex;gap:1rem;border-radius:.9rem}._trackImg_1kac2_11{border-radius:.5rem;width:50px;height:50px}._trackDetails_1kac2_17{width:100%;display:grid;grid-template:1fr 1fr / 5fr 3fr 2fr 1fr;align-items:center;min-width:0;column-gap:1rem}._trackTitle_1kac2_26,._trackArtist_1kac2_27,._trackAlbum_1kac2_28{min-width:0;max-width:100%;white-space:nowrap;overflow:hidden;text-overflow:ellipsis}._trackTitle_1kac2_26{font-size:1.05rem;grid-area:1 / 1 / 2 / 2}._trackArtist_1kac2_27{font-size:.85rem;grid-area:2 / 1 / 3 / 2;color:#b4b4b4}._trackAlbum_1kac2_28{font-size:.85rem;grid-area:1 / 2 / 3 / 3;justify-self:flex-start;color:#b4b4b4}._trackDuration_1kac2_54{font-size:.85rem;grid-area:1 / 3 / 3 / 4;justify-self:center}._plusIcon_1kac2_60{grid-area:1 / 4 / 3 / 5;font-size:1.2rem;line-height:1;padding:4px 6px;border-radius:10rem;justify-self:center}._plusIcon_1kac2_60:hover{cursor:pointer;background-color:#b4b4b473}._plusIcon_1kac2_60:active{color:#b4b4b473;background-color:#b4b4b433}@media only screen and (max-width: 540px){._trackDetails_1kac2_17{grid-template:1fr 1fr / 3fr 1fr}._plusIcon_1kac2_60{grid-area:1 / 2 / 3 / 3}._trackDuration_1kac2_54,._trackAlbum_1kac2_28{display:none}}._playlistHeader_hj4zl_1{width:100%;display:flex;align-items:end;justify-content:space-between;margin-bottom:1rem;min-width:0}._playlistTitle_hj4zl_11{flex:1;min-width:0;max-width:100%;font-size:1.7rem;font-weight:600;line-height:1;white-space:nowrap;overflow:hidden;text-overflow:ellipsis}._playlistSave_hj4zl_23{margin-left:10px;padding:.5rem 1rem;white-space:nowrap}._playlist_hj4zl_1{overflow:hidden;padding:1.5rem;background-color:#1f1f1f;border-radius:.7rem}@media only screen and (max-width: 1060px){._playlist_hj4zl_1{max-height:400px}}@media only screen and (max-width: 540px){._playlistTitleInput_hj4zl_43,._playlistTitle_hj4zl_11{font-size:1.5rem}._playlistSave_hj4zl_23{font-size:.9rem}}._savingModalContainer_1yrbr_1{z-index:10;position:fixed;top:0;display:none}._savingModalContainer_1yrbr_1._show_1yrbr_8{height:100%;width:100%;display:flex;justify-content:center;align-items:center;background-color:#0f0f0f99;-webkit-backdrop-filter:blur(1px);backdrop-filter:blur(1px)}._savingModal_1yrbr_1{padding:2rem;border-radius:1rem;background:linear-gradient(#1e1e1e 30%,#0f0f0f);display:flex;flex-direction:column;gap:2rem}._modalHeader_1yrbr_27{display:flex;align-items:center;justify-content:space-between;margin-bottom:2rem;line-height:1}._modalHeader_1yrbr_27 span{font-size:2rem;font-weight:600}._modalHeader_1yrbr_27 i{font-size:2rem;color:#c8c8c8}._modalHeader_1yrbr_27 i:hover{cursor:pointer;color:#f5f5f5}._inputContainer_1yrbr_50{width:100%;align-self:center;display:flex;flex-direction:column;align-items:flex-start}._inputContainer_1yrbr_50 label{color:#c8c8c8}._inputContainer_1yrbr_50 input[type=text],._inputContainer_1yrbr_50 textarea{width:100%;padding:2px 4px;color:#f5f5f5;font-size:1rem;background-color:#32323280;border:none;border-radius:.5rem}._inputContainer_1yrbr_50 textarea{height:100px;resize:none}._inputContainer_1yrbr_50 input[type=text]:focus,._inputContainer_1yrbr_50 textarea:focus{outline:1px solid rgb(60,60,60,.9)}._radioValues_1yrbr_83{margin-top:.5rem;width:100%;display:flex;justify-content:space-around}._radioValues_1yrbr_83 label{font-weight:500;color:#f5f5f5;margin-left:5px}._radioValues_1yrbr_83 input[type=radio]{accent-color:#4CAF50;margin-right:5px}._radioValues_1yrbr_83 input[type=radio]:hover,._radioValues_1yrbr_83 label{cursor:pointer}@media only screen and (max-width: 540px){._savingModalContainer_1yrbr_1._show_1yrbr_8{background-color:#0f0f0fb3}._modalHeader_1yrbr_27 span{font-size:1.5rem}}._notificationContainer_x58gk_1{padding:0 .5rem;position:fixed;z-index:15;top:20px}._notification_x58gk_1{display:flex;align-items:center;padding-left:10px;background-color:#242424;border-radius:5px;text-align:center;animation:_fadeIn_x58gk_1 .3s ease-in-out}._notification_x58gk_1._warning_x58gk_18{color:#bb7900;border-left:5px solid rgb(216,140,0)}._notification_x58gk_1._error_x58gk_23{color:#e93030;border-left:5px solid rgb(180,0,0)}._notification_x58gk_1._success_x58gk_28{color:#32c232;border-left:5px solid rgb(38,148,38)}._xMark_x58gk_33{height:100%;margin-left:10px;padding:12px;background-color:#2e2e2e;border-top-right-radius:5px;border-bottom-right-radius:5px}._xMark_x58gk_33._warning_x58gk_18:hover{cursor:pointer;background-color:#d88c00;color:#2e2e2e}._xMark_x58gk_33._error_x58gk_23:hover{cursor:pointer;background-color:#d80000;color:#2e2e2e}._xMark_x58gk_33._success_x58gk_28:hover{cursor:pointer;background-color:#32c232;color:#2e2e2e}@keyframes _fadeIn_x58gk_1{0%{opacity:0;transform:translateY(-20px)}to{opacity:1;transform:translateY(0)}}._embedContainer_1l861_1{grid-area:span 1 / span 2;min-height:360px;width:100%;height:100%;display:none;flex-direction:column;justify-content:center;align-items:center;background-color:#222222b6;border-radius:12px}._embedContainer_1l861_1._playlistEmbedded_1l861_14{display:flex}._embedHeader_1l861_18{width:100%;padding:1rem;display:flex;align-items:center;justify-content:space-between}._embedHeader_1l861_18 span{font-size:1.1rem;font-weight:500}._xMark_1l861_31{font-size:1.1rem}._xMark_1l861_31:hover{cursor:pointer}._spotifyEmbed_1l861_39{font-size:.8rem;width:100%;height:100%;min-height:360px;border:none}@media only screen and (max-width: 1060px){._embedContainer_1l861_1{grid-area:span 1 / span 1}}
